WebFuji, a 36-year-old bottlenose dolphin (Tursiops truncates) living in Japan's Okinawa Churaumi Aquarium, has a big fish tale to tell.In the fall of 2002, she lost 75 percent of her tail flukes to an unknown disease. But the mother of three got a new lease on life when she was fitted with artificial tail flukes. WebMar 20, 2024 · dolphin, any of the toothed whales belonging to the mammal family Delphinidae (oceanic dolphins) as well as the families Platanistidae and Iniidae, the two that contain the river dolphins.
